Platinum Investment Management Ltd. raised its holdings in shares of Structure Therapeutics Inc. (NASDAQ:GPCR - Free Report) by 30.9%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 74,900 shares of the company's stock after purchasing an additional 17,670 shares during the quarter. Platinum Investment Management Ltd. owned approximately 0.13% of Structure Therapeutics worth $2,031,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Structure Therapeutics Profile

(Free Report)

Structure Therapeutics Inc, a clinical stage global biopharmaceutical company, develops and delivers novel oral therapeutics to treat a range of chronic diseases with unmet medical needs. The company's lead product candidate is GSBR-1290, an oral and biased small molecule agonist of glucagon-like-peptide-1 receptor, a validated G-protein-coupled receptors (GPCRs) drug target for type-2 diabetes mellitus and obesity.
